Our lead fiction this month is by the colourful Jack Trevor Story, who lives in
Hampstead, enjoys drinking in pubs, and is never less than prolific as a writer.
For this month's interview Mike Bygrave, late of Time Out and now one of the country's
brightest young journalists (also the author of a splendid novel, About Time,
published in paperback by Quartet at 60p), tackles the high-powered financial
world encompassed by Mark McCormack. A Jay Gatsby -figure on the international
sports scene, Mr McCormack has evolutionised the business by turning famous sportsmen
into glamorous figures and making a mint in the process.
